0 dyle Posted July 9, 2002 Share Posted July 9, 2002 To add a shortcut, just go to REGEDIT, HKEY_CURRENT_USER > Software > geo > Plugins. Find the ge0Launch plugin that you just added (There's usually two sets of numbers after the label e.g. geOlaunch2_1 --> means first ge0launch plugin in the second geobar. There should be a "File Path" key there, just enter the full path of the program or folder refresh geoshell. After you do that, the link should work already. I also had some problems with the icons when i started using it. geOshell uses its own set of icons in the geoshell directory. If you don't want to manually change the links of the icons in regedit, just replace the ones in the geoshell icons directory with your own, using the same file name. I backed up the icons folder first in case i might need the default icons in the future but once you replace them, just refresh the shell and it should be fine.
